Freetrade vs Interactive Investor Comparison
For our 2022 Review, we assessed the best trading platforms in the UK for online share dealing. Let's compare Freetrade vs Interactive Investor.
Which broker is less expensive?
Alongside the cost per trade, most UK online brokers also charge a monthly, quarterly, or annual management fee, which varies based on the account type and balance. Based on our thorough review, Freetrade offers better pricing than Interactive Investor for share dealing.
Assuming a £30,000 portfolio size, here are the total annual costs for share dealing with both brokers, given different monthly activity scenarios.
5 trades per year - Freetrade would cost N/A per year, while Interactive Investor would cost £119.88 per year.
12 trades per year - Freetrade would cost £0 per year, while Interactive Investor would cost £119.88 per year.
36 trades per year - Freetrade would cost £0 per year, while Interactive Investor would cost £263.64 (investor) 287.76 (super investor) per year.
120 trades per year - Freetrade would cost £0 per year, while Interactive Investor would cost £766.8 (investor) 622.92 (super investor) per year.
3 fund trades per year - Freetrade would cost N/A per year, while Interactive Investor would cost £119.88 per year.
Which broker offers a wider range of investment options?
Freetrade offers investors access to ISA, SIPP, Share Trading, ETFs and Investment Trusts, while Interactive Investor offers investors access to ISA, SIPP, Share Trading, Funds, ETFs, Bonds - Corporate, Bonds - Government (Gilts) and Investment Trusts, neither have CFD Trading, Spread Betting, Crypto Trading and Advisor Services. Which broker offers better research?
Our testing concluded that Interactive Investor is better for research than Freetrade. Interactive Investor offers more research options, including research reports, articles, and analyst ratings.
Which trading platform is better?
To compare the trading platforms of both Freetrade and Interactive Investor, we tested each broker's website, trading platform, trading tools and stock trading app. All features compared, Interactive Investor offers a better share dealing platform and Freetrade offers a better stock app for mobile trading.
